Why timely heat pump repair matters in Paradise Valley
Paradise Valley sits in a desert climate with prolonged high temperatures, intense sun exposure, and seasonal monsoon dust and debris. That environment accelerates wear on outdoor units, leads to clogged coils and filters, and increases run-time during summer months. Delaying repair can cause:
- Reduced cooling and heating efficiency, raising utility bills
- Progressive component damage (compressor, fan motor, electrical)
- Risk of refrigerant leaks and frozen coils
- Shortened equipment life and more costly replacements later
Addressing problems early preserves efficiency, restores comfort quickly, and limits the scope of repairs.
Common heat pump issues in Paradise Valley, AZ
Homeowners in the region encounter a predictable set of problems due to climate and usage patterns:
- Poor cooling or heating output — often from low refrigerant, clogged coils, or failing compressors
- Short cycling or frequent on/off — caused by electrical faults, incorrect thermostat settings, or faulty capacitors
- Frozen or iced outdoor coil — caused by restricted airflow, low refrigerant, or defrost system failure
- Loud or unusual noises — failing fan motors, loose components, or compressor distress
- Fan not running or intermittent operation — capacitor, motor, or control board issues
- Reversing valve problems — heat pump may not switch properly between heating and cooling
- Drainage and condensate problems — blocked drain lines from dust, pollen, or sticky residue after monsoon storms
- Electrical failures — tripped breakers, burned contactors, or failed relays
- Reduced airflow indoors — dirty filters, duct leaks, or blower motor issues
Diagnostic process you should expect
A professional heat pump repair technician follows a structured diagnostic process to isolate the problem efficiently:
- Visual and safety inspection: Check panels, wiring, refrigerant lines, and visible damage. Confirm safety switches and breakers.
- Thermostat verification: Confirm correct mode, setpoints, and thermostat calibration.
- Airflow assessment: Measure supply and return airflow, inspect filters and ductwork for restrictions.
- Electrical testing: Evaluate capacitors, contactors, relays, and motor current draw using a multimeter and amp clamp.
- Refrigerant analysis: Check pressure and temperature differentials to detect leaks or low charge.
- Component function tests: Operate compressor, outdoor fan, reversing valve, and defrost control to observe behavior and error codes.
- Indoor coil and condensate check: Inspect indoor coil condition and drainage paths for blockages or mold.
- Diagnostic report and options: Provide clear findings, recommend repairs or replacement, and explain risks of deferring action.
Technicians will document measured values so you can see why a repair is recommended.
Typical repair procedures and what they involve
Repairs range from simple to complex. Common procedures include:
- Replacing capacitors and contactors: Fast, common fixes for starting or intermittent issues.
- Cleaning coils and replacing filters: Restores airflow and heat transfer efficiency; critical after monsoon dust.
- Repairing refrigerant leaks and recharging system: Requires leak location, repair, and accurate recharge to manufacturer specifications.
- Fan motor replacement: Involves removing the outdoor fan assembly and installing a matched motor or OEM equivalent.
- Compressor repair or replacement: Compressor issues are serious. Technicians may test winding resistance and oil; replacement is costly and sometimes leads to system replacement depending on age.
- Replacing reversing valves or defrost controls: Fixes improper heat/cool switching and defrost cycle failures.
- Control board and thermostat repairs: Address communication and cycling issues with calibrated replacements.
- Drain line clearing and condensate pump servicing: Ensures proper condensate removal to prevent overflow and indoor moisture issues.
Most repairs are done on-site, but complexity (e.g., compressor replacement or brazing refrigerant lines) increases labor and parts lead time.
Parts availability in Paradise Valley and the Phoenix Metro
The Phoenix metro area is well-served by HVAC parts distributors. Common wear items like capacitors, contactors, fan motors, filters, and most control boards are typically available same-day. OEM compressors, specialty reversing valves, or older model components may require ordering and can take 24 to 72 hours depending on stock and brand.
Expect technicians to use OEM parts where warranty or long-term reliability matters, and they may offer high-quality aftermarket alternatives when OEM parts are discontinued. In Paradise Valley, many service providers maintain a stocked truck inventory of the most common parts to enable fast first-visit repairs.

Warranty considerations and protecting coverage
Understanding warranties helps avoid denied claims:
- Manufacturer product warranties typically cover specific components for a set period; labor is often excluded or limited.
- Parts warranties differ between OEM and aftermarket components; keep documentation for any replaced part.
- Improper DIY repairs, using nonapproved refrigerants, or neglecting recommended maintenance can void warranties.
- Documented regular maintenance and professional repairs strengthen warranty claims and help technicians diagnose issues faster.
Always ask for a written parts and labor warranty for any repair work performed. Retain invoices and service records for warranty transfers if you sell the home.

Maintenance tips to minimize repairs
Simple homeowner steps reduce repair frequency:
- Replace filters monthly during heavy use
- Keep the outdoor unit clear of vegetation, debris, and irrigation spray
- Shade the outdoor unit where practical without blocking airflow
- Clean the indoor and outdoor coils on schedule or have a pro service them annually
- Avoid changing thermostat settings drastically and use a programmable thermostat correctly
- Schedule annual professional tune-ups before summer and after monsoon season
